The International Federation of American Football has a new president.
And it is a Frenchman who now occupies this chair.
Pierre Trochet was indeed elected on Saturday at the head of the IFAF which brings together 74 national federations.
A former French American football international, he succeeds the Canadian Richard MacLean, in office since 2017.
The goal of the Olympics
The IFAF, founded in 1998 and "currently in the process of full recognition by the IOC", hopes to join the Olympic program through "flag football", a 5v5 and contactless version of American football.
This could be done on the occasion of the Olympics-2028 in Los Angeles.
